Chegg (CHGG) Director Ted Schlein Receives 119,784 RSU Award

What Happened
Ted Schlein, a member of Chegg's board of directors, received an award of 119,784 restricted stock units (RSUs) on 2026-06-16. The RSUs were granted at $0.00 (typical for equity awards) and represent a contingent right to one share of Chegg common stock upon vesting. The shares underlying these RSUs will vest on the one-year anniversary of the grant (subject to continued board service).

Context
RSU grants to directors are routine compensation and represent a deferred equity award that converts to shares upon vesting; they are not purchases or sales and do not signal an immediate change in market exposure. Because these are time-based RSUs, there is no immediate cash or share transfer; any future sale would occur only after vesting (and any applicable company trading restrictions).
